Root cause traced to the Orenfall layout engine upgrade earlier that afternoon, which silently changed its node-batching default from incremental to eager, exhausting the renderer's memory budget. We reverted to the prior engine version, added an explicit batching config so future upgrades cannot flip the default unnoticed, and backfilled a regression test at 5,000 edges. All affected dashboards recovered within twelve minutes. The reverted build's token is recorded below.

build token for kagaf-hahof: htk14_9d3d4d26d7d8de

**Action item (plugin authors):** OrderVault now soft-deletes rows instead of hard-deleting them. Your plugins must filter on the deletion flag or you'll surface ghost orders, which is exactly what broke the Kestrel Point storefront. Purge timing and retention are controlled by core, not plugins — don't try to override them. The relevant constants are reproduced below.

tuning constants:
TIERS = {
    "pelwyn": 241,
    "praeth": 713,
    "quenys": 929,
}

UserSplit Cutover Drift: the extracted account service and the legacy Marigold monolith user module are reporting divergent record counts during dual-write. This fires when drift exceeds 0.5% over 15 minutes. New team members should not replay writes manually. Reconciliation steps and the rollback procedure are documented on the internal page.

wiki page, tajog-fafog: https://gitlab.paliqsys.corp/dash/display/job/853dd6fcbf54

For your review scope: responsibility for the soft-delete mechanism on the Cartholm orders table is transferring this week. This covers the `deleted_at` tombstone logic, the purge job that hard-deletes rows after the 90-day retention window, and the access-control checks preventing soft-deleted orders from appearing in customer-facing queries. All prior design decisions and exception approvals are documented in the retention register. Going forward, any security findings in this area should be assigned to the individual named below.

named custodian: Quenath Oliox